Lentil Greek Salad with Dill Sauce Recipe

Lentil Greek Salad with Dill Sauce

Ingredients

Scale
  • 1 cup green lentils (cooked)
  • 1 medium English cucumber (diced)
  • 1 pint cherry tomatoes (halved)
  • ½ red onion (finely diced)
  • ½ cup feta cheese (crumbled)
  • ½ cup Greek yogurt
  • 2 tablespoons fresh dill (chopped)
  • 2 tablespoons olive oil
  • Juice of ½ lemon
  • Salt and pepper to taste

Instructions

  1. Rinse the green lentils under cold water before cooking. In a pot, combine lentils with three cups of water. Bring to a boil, then reduce heat and simmer for 20-25 minutes until tender but not mushy. Drain and let cool.
  2. While the lentils cook, prepare the vegetables: dice the cucumber, halve the cherry tomatoes, and finely chop the red onion.
  3. In a mixing bowl, whisk together Greek yogurt, dill, minced garlic, olive oil, and lemon juice until smooth.
  4. In a large bowl, combine cooled lentils with prepared vegetables. Drizzle with dill sauce and toss gently until well coated.
  5. Season with salt and pepper to taste. Serve chilled or at room temperature.
